Endlessly versatile, dumbbells are an essential addition to any fitness regimen or home gym. Arm rows, goblet squats, chest presses, bicep curls... there are hundreds of workouts packed into one simple piece of equipment that strengthen and tone vital muscles throughout your upper body and core. Lighter weights can also complement aerobic exercise with extra resistance to burn more calories. Utilize hand weights to supercharge activities like power walking, jogging, even physical therapy and yoga.
